Outcomes-based Program Evaluation
Your stakeholders want to know what impact you achieve through your programs and services. You need to be able to clearly articulate your impact. OBPE is a methodology that assists you to clearly identify the client/community outcomes your programs and services are designed to achieve. It also helps you identify appropriate ways to assess to what extent you achieve these outcomes. This methodology can be used when designing a new program or to effectively measure an existing program. It is a powerful way to communicate the importance of what you do.
